I was totally inspired that very day by a free pattern I saw for a circle in a square afghan.


It was in my daily email from All Free Crochet!





I made 3 squares using my favorite Lion Brand Amazing Yarn for the circles and then used some fabulous wool yarn I found at Goodwill for $1 per skein for the outer square and border!

I had no idea what I would make from it when I found it a few months ago, but I knew I had to get it! :)


I think it was the perfect yarn to use to really make the Amazing yarn pop!





After I made 3 squares from the free afghan pattern, I blocked them with pins and some water to reshape them.


When they where dry, I sewed them together and crocheted a border around them and then blocked them again.


As soon as it was dry, I unblocked it and hung it! :)
